The TL16C752D-Q1 device can decode positive pulses on RX. The timing is different, but the variation is
invisible to the UART. The decoder, which works from the falling edge, now recognizes a 0 on the trailing edge of
the pulse rather than on the leading edge. As long as the pulse duration is fairly constant, as defined by the
specification, the trailing edges should also be 16 clock cycles apart and data can readily be decoded. The 0
appears on Int_RX after the pulse rather than at the start of it.
